Output ef15c56a4a436d3000987becfc36a9a47f4b77f74c3faa6ae36c257f57679352:0
- value
- 26863806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fba08da0ae3cc47c1c397b8b803bfce25ce4adb OP_EQUAL
- address
- 3EnyQtFo3Qid4ZTnSUayoLaEctWN3zZVpT
- transaction
- ef15c56a4a436d3000987becfc36a9a47f4b77f74c3faa6ae36c257f57679352